Managing Diabetes in the Workplace: Tips and Strategies

Diabetes is a serious medical condition that affects millions of people all over the world. In the United States, an estimated 30.3 million people are living with diabetes and 1.5 million new cases of diabetes are diagnosed each year. For those living with diabetes, managing the condition in the workplace can be a challenge. Fortunately, there are some strategies that can be employed to make managing diabetes at work easier.

Creating a Supportive Workplace Environment

Creating a supportive workplace environment is one of the key strategies for managing diabetes in the workplace. By making adjustments to the work environment, it is possible to enable employees to better manage their condition. This can include making changes to their workspace, such as providing a comfortable chair or adjustable desk, or providing sugar-free snacks to help maintain blood sugar levels. Additionally, employers can provide access to health services, such as dieticians, to provide additional resources and advice. Providing education and training to other staff members can also be beneficial in creating awareness and understanding of the condition.

Encouraging Open Communication

Encouraging open communication between employees and managers is another key strategy for managing diabetes in the workplace. Employees should be encouraged to discuss their condition and any adjustments or support they may need to better manage it. Additionally, employers should provide a confidential environment in which employees can discuss their condition. This can help to create a sense of understanding and empathy that can go a long way in creating a supportive atmosphere. Additionally, employers should be aware of any laws or regulations that may be in place to protect employees with diabetes from discrimination.

Developing a Diabetes Management Plan

Developing a diabetes management plan is another tip for managing diabetes in the workplace. A plan should be developed in collaboration with the employee and the employer. This plan can include the individual's specific needs and accommodations, such as adjusting work tasks or schedules, as well as emergency procedures in case of a medical emergency. Additionally, the plan should include regular monitoring of the employee's condition, such as regular blood sugar tests, to ensure that the condition is being managed properly.

Managing diabetes in the workplace can be a challenge, but with the right strategies and support it is possible to create an environment that is supportive and understanding. By making adjustments to the workplace environment, encouraging open communication, and developing a diabetes management plan, employers can ensure that those living with diabetes can work with greater comfort and safety.
